How to Spot Common Plumbing Concerns
Detecting frequent plumbing concerns is crucial for homeowners looking to keep their property in good condition. One of the clearest signs of plumbing trouble is water infiltration, commonly presenting as wet areas on walls or ceilings. Residents should also pay attention to strange noises, such as drains gurgling or pipes making banging sounds, which may signal blockages or disrupted water flow.
Slow drainage in sinks and tubs can signal clogs in the plumbing system, while an unexpected rise in water bills could suggest concealed leaks. Additionally, changes in water pressure can suggest issues with pipes or fixtures. Homeowners are advised to inspect their water heater for any signs of rust or leakage, as these can lead to more significant problems. By identifying these warning signs, homeowners can tackle plumbing problems before they worsen, potentially saving time and money in repairs.

Effective Leak Detection Techniques
Catching leaks ahead of time can save homeowners significant time and money in repairs. Various effective techniques exist for identifying leaks within a home. One common method involves visual inspections, where homeowners inspect walls and ceilings for water stains, wet areas, or signs of mold. Additionally, monitoring water bills for unexplained increases can indicate hidden leaks.
An additional useful method includes using a moisture meter, which can detect elevated moisture levels in building materials. When more sophisticated detection is required, acoustic leak detection employs dedicated microphones to listen for the sound of water escaping pipes. Infrared cameras can also be utilized to detect temperature discrepancies that might reveal concealed leaks behind wall surfaces.
Additionally, pressure-based testing can effectively detect leaks in plumbing systems by evaluating the drop in pipe pressure. Applying these methods enables homeowners to quickly address leaks, avoiding more significant damage and expensive repairs in the future.

Key Factors That Impact the Price of Plumbing Services
False assumptions about plumbing costs can lead to unexpected expenses. A number of important factors affect the cost of plumbing services. First, the complexity of the issue plays a significant role; minor repairs usually come at a lower cost than major installations or full system replacements. Furthermore, the duration needed to finish the work can influence labor costs, especially in emergency scenarios that call for immediate action.
Furthermore, one's geographic location influences service rates. Urban areas often experience higher rates due to increased demand and living costs. The choice of materials also influences expenses; high-end fixtures and parts have the potential to increase the total expense. Finally, the plumber's experience and reputation can lead to varying rates, since experienced tradespeople tend to command higher fees for their skills. To avoid unexpected costs and ensure excellent service, homeowners are advised to keep these factors in mind when setting a plumbing budget.

How Can You Tell If You Have a Hidden Leak?
Common signs of a hidden leak involve water marks on walls or ceilings, an unexpected rise in water bills, musty or mildew-like smells, and the presence of water sounds when no plumbing fixtures are being used.
What Are the Best Ways to Prevent Frozen Pipes in Winter?
To avoid frozen pipes during winter, homeowners should add insulation to exposed pipes, keep the home heated, let faucets drip at a slow rate, and open cabinet doors to circulate warm air. Consistent upkeep is also critical for the best possible protection.
Which Plumbing Tools Should Every Homeowner Own?
All homeowners needs to keep essential plumbing equipment such as a drain plunger, pipe wrench, multi-purpose adjustable wrench, basin wrench, plumber's tape, and a plumbing snake. Such tools allow for effective maintenance and minor repairs, ensuring a well-functioning residential plumbing system.
